This stunning specimen features a vibrant Rubellite Reddish Pink Tourmaline crystal nestled alongside delicate sheets of Albite, originating from the mineral-rich regions of Afghanistan. The Rubellite crystal displays a vivid, saturated pink to reddish-pink hue, characteristic of high-quality tourmaline, with excellent luster and natural striations that highlight its prismatic form. Complementing the bold tourmaline is the Albite, a variety of albite feldspar, presenting in shimmering, pearly-white, bladed formations that create a striking contrast against the vibrant tourmaline.
